_0.063-0.5 =0.063-1.0 _0.063-4.0 128 ,ug/ml). Like tosufloxacin, OPC-17116 was highly active against S. pneumoniae and Streptococcus pyogenes, with MIC90s of 0.125 and 0.25 ,ug/ml, respectively. OPC-17116 was more active against Enterococcusfaecalis than the other drugs tested, except tosufloxacin, with an MIC90 of 0.5 pug/ml. Although OPC-17116 exhibited no marked advantages over the other drugs in activity against gram-negative bacteria, it generally exhibited potent activity against members of the family Enterobacteriaceae.
